After you get offers you will have the leverage you need to ask probing questions about firm culture to associates before accepting. Just make sure that you’re asking politely. Women associates especially will understand what you’re getting at
Sexual harassment is widespread at law firms. But that does not make it legal or acceptable.
You might want to ask the Women in Law bowl about the firm’s reputation.
Certain firms do have worse reputations for sexual harassment than others. For example, one associate shared that his former firm had a pool party so that they could see female associates in their bathing suits.
You can also draw inferences. Check out if women are in leadership positions in your target practice group, or even partners. Talk to former female associates. Research the kinds of clients and cases the partners made their names on, to see if they have a history of representing sexual harassers.

No reason not to call out the firm specifically as that will get you better responses. It’s certainly not the case at all firms especially as firms have buttoned up their summers more recently.
As an example, Latham has historically been viewed as a fratty firm but our summer program has been toned down to such an extreme that it’s an entirely different experience to what it was before covid. If recruiting hears about an afterparty following a sanctioned event, it’s no longer a matter of not covering costs, it’s a matter of looping in HR and not being invited to participate in the summer program going forward.
